Leading developer MRP has commenced construction of The Portland Building, a new £28m office scheme on the corner of Church Street and Portland Street in Brighton that will see the revitalisation of a site that has lain vacant for more than 20 years.

WrapUp campaign to help homeless and vulnerable includes Worthing for the first time
“Warm A Heart, Give A Coat” is the motto of the #WrapUpWorthing coat collection that Rotary Clubs are launching in Worthing for the first time this November. Due to increased demand, the campaign has expanded from Brighton and Hove, where thanks to the generosity of local people, it’s been running successfully for the last 4 years.

Port Kitchen becomes the first café in Sussex to achieve prestigious Green Tourism Gold Award
Port Kitchen at Shoreham Port opened in June this year and we have already achieved the highest recognition from green accreditation organisation Green Tourism.
